Role of EuroGeographics Coordinate & facilitate the creation of and access to reference data for Europe Focus on: Development of technical specifications for metadata & reference data Implementation of the specifications Pricing & licensing policies Procedures & Processes Partnerships Focal point for the EC (and others) - the ‘European Gateway’ to Europe’s National Mapping Agencies

Products: SABE 10 years on the market Main versions: 1991, 1995, 1997 New coming updates: SABE2001 / Census – December 2002 SABE2001 + SIRE codes – autumn 2003 Harmonisation with other EG products - e.g. EuroGlobalMap and EuroRegionalMap http://www.eurogeographics.org/Projects/SABE

Coverage: SABE2001 / Census production New countries in the first release (Dec 02): Malta, Moldova, Romania (?), Turkey (?), Ukraine Expected: Bulgaria, Albania Russia Belarus Armenia Light green: No information (IT and PL), status 97 Meanwhile Poland delivered data, but may be too late there are a few countries like Ireland or Estonia which informed about no change against 1997, those are not discriminated mid green and slightly hatched: incomplete or not according spec, resp. (Ii.e. Romania and Turkey) supposed to be included in 2nd release Red contours: new SABE countries (i.e Moldavia, Malta, Romania, Turkey, Ukraine Grey countries: no contact until now Yellow countries should be encouraged to provide data; they are candidates for spring 2003 release

Products: EuroGlobalMap Global (500k-1M) scale covering 36 countries Network approach to creation through regional coordinators Target for delivery: EU+ – Spring 2003 Europe – Autumn 2003 http://www.eurogeographics.org/egm

Products: EuroGlobalMap Content: Administrative boundaries, Hydrography Transport Settlements Elevation Geographical names EGM is the European contribution to GlobalMapping Licensing will be applicable, but price should meet users ability to pay It was already recognised by rivers’ commissions as useful dataset for reporting according to Water Framework Directive

Products: EuroRegionalMap Regional/national scale (1:250k) covering 7 countries Target for delivery – October 2003 Prototype for whole Europe (extension is considered) http://www.eurogeographics.org/erm

Vision Achieve interoperability of European mapping (and other GI) data within 10 years

Vision (for the user) Easy to identify what data are available Confident that the data: conforms to known specifications and meets defined quality levels is maintained at the most appropriate level The terms & conditions under which the data can be used are clear and do not impede its use Tools available to combine data seamlessly

Twin tracks Small scales pan-European data ‘centralised’ model Medium & large scales cross border data ‘decentralised’, framework model Convergence

Why this vision? Increasing needs for cross border GI Technology & ‘open’ standards Complements national (and global) SDIs Complements the role of the NMAs at the national level Provides a framework for sharing best practice and developing partnerships

Action plan - principles Customer and business focused “find the main drivers” Step by step think big, start small (“incremental benefit”) “good solution today, is better than a perfect solution tomorrow” Short term actions (next 2 years) improve access to existing data create initial pan-European reference data develop specifications, procedures & policies to support decentralised (distributed) vision Partnership

Projects: New Metadata Replacement / update of GDDD: Discovery level service - early 2003 Comprehensive metadata system – end 2003: ISO 19115 Decentralised approach Multilingual gateway

Projects: EuroSpec Data Specifications Common data catalogue Harmonised data model Data interoperability and quality Mapping EuroSpec with national DB Conversion rules Gaps and weaknesses in existing DBs Implementation guidelines Transformation mechanisms Prototypes and testbeds

Projects: Pricing & Licensing Objective: to develop the terms & conditions under which the data can be used are clear and do not impede its use Deliverables: Licensing guidelines License templates Legal terminology Pricing guidelines Market pricing Pricing levels Distribution of revenue Time-scale: June 2002 – March 2003
